Above 1000 Needy Families Distributed Cash Aid In Wardak
MAIDAN SHAHR (Pajhwok): More than one thousand needy families were distributed cash assistance in the Behsud district of central Maidan Wardak province, the Rural Rehabilitation and Development Department said on Friday.
The department in a press release said the assistance was distributed among 1,051 needy families by the World Food Programme (WFP) in coordination with the technical assistance of TSDO organization.
Each family received 2,900 afghanis.
The Rural Rehabilitation and Development said it plans to distribute similar assistance to the needy in a number of other districts in the future.
It comes days after cash assistance was provided to over 1,400 needy families in the Chak district of the province.
